Job description

Are you excited about the cloud computing industry and leveraging data analytics technologies and methodologies? Are you interested in driving business decisions through data analysis, reporting, and KPIs?

We’re looking for someone who possesses a solid BI engineering background, familiar with maintaining large data sets, building the datasets needed for analyzing information, identifying key business insights, and working with stakeholders in generating the right metrics to define and measure success. In this role, you will be a technical expert with significant scope and impact. You will work with Sales Operation Leaders, Product Managers and other business users to understand the business requirements and implement reporting solutions. The individual must have the ability to earn trust and communicate effectively across multiple technical and non-technical business units in a global organization. Candidates should possess a keen sense of ownership, collaboration, and desire to learn. Above all the candidate should be passionate about bringing large datasets together to answer business questions and drive change.

Key job responsibilities

Work directly with the models/data. Work with large data sets and the technical tools needed to work with them

Write high quality SQL queries to retrieve and analyze data from database tables (ex. Redshift, MySQL). Build data models leveraging Python.

Partner with business owners, tech and central teams to integrate machine-learning, generative AI, and automation into scaling our programs and processes

Use analytical and statistical rigor to solve complex problems and drive business decisions

Drive towards simple, scalable solutions to difficult problems

Project-manage multiple workflows and communicate complex analytical results, both written and verbally

Work with key business stakeholders to understand requirements and shape analytical deliverables

Think strategically about business, product, and technical challenges, with the ability to work cross-organizationally

Requirements

5+ years of SQL, ETL or Oracle experience

  • 5+ years of performing statistical analysis experience

  • 1+ years of developing automated reporting experience

  • Experience programming to extract, transform and clean large (multi-TB) data sets

  • Experience with theory and practice of information retrieval, data science, machine learning and data mining

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ience working directly with business stakeholders to translate between data and business needs

  • Experience managing, analyzing and communicating results to senior leadership

  • Master’s degree in statistics, data science, or an equivalent quantitative field

  • Experience in scripting for automation (e.g. Python) and advanced SQL skills.
